1. Issued in Connecticut?

President Obama's Social Security number (if he hasn't been issued a new one since his original one was spread all over the Internet) begins with the digits 042. While this is ordinarily an indication that the number was issued to someone living in Connecticut, the Social Security Administration says:

One should not make too much of the "geographical code." It is not meant to be any kind of useable geographical information. The numbering scheme was designed in 1936 (before computers) to make it easier for SSA to store the applications in our files in Baltimore since the files were organized by regions as well as alphabetically. It was really just a bookkeeping device for our own internal use and was never intended to be anything more than that.

So how did President Obama get a Social Security number with an Area Number reflecting residence (or mailing address) in Connecticut?
......
In any event, there is no evidence whatever that President Obama's Social Securiy number was obtained by fraud.
